COLUMBUS – Doug Wiley ran into a buzz saw.
Wiley, a senior for the Chesapeake Panthers, lost in the opening round of the Ohio High School Athletic Association Division III state wrestling tournament at the Ohio State University Schottenstein Center.
The 189-pound Wiley faced Jordan Spore of Cincinnati Wyoming in his first match and lost a major decision, 16-5.
Spore was a starter for the Wyoming football team that placed first in Region 16 of Division IV in the computer playoff ratings.
The setback left Wiley with an impressive final record of 32-10. Wiley finished fourth in the Southeast District meet.
